A blogger was shot dead in Mexico during a live TikTok broadcast.

A tragedy occurred in Mexico - 23-year-old blogger Valeria Marques was shot during a live TikTok broadcast. The horrific event took place in a beauty salon in Guadalajara. A man burst in and fired a gun, reports BBC, citing the Jalisco state prosecutor's office.
The investigation is looking into the version of femicide (the killing of a woman because of her gender). The motive for the murder remains unknown.
Gender-based violence is becoming increasingly prevalent in Mexico. According to the UN, partners or family members kill 10 women or girls every day.
According to another version, the blogger's life was taken by a man who pretended to bring a gift. It is known that she had previously written on social media about a potential threat from an ex-partner. Social media is flooded with her posts following the tragic event.
